S3 Corps Inc. Employee

"I don't think reviewing my current employer would be prudent. The job focuses on evaluating the possibility of the sharing of spectrum by DoD assets and the commercial industry. CBRS and AWS-3 are two examples of commercial use of spectrum that is currently occupied by DoD telecommunication systems."
